Barbara Thompson, age 85, born July 17, 1934 in Columbus, OH, went to be home with the Lord on Tuesday, June 23, 2020. She was a graduate of East High School and retired from The Ohio State University. Barbara was a member of Temple of Compassion Church where she shared her love for Jesus Christ. In Him, she found a best friend. Barbara was loved by many and always had you laughing! You couldn't have a bad day without her making you laugh or trying to fight! Lol. She was preceded in death by her husband Hershel Ray Thompson, parents Deacons Daniel and Ovetta Munnerlyn, sister Phyllis Smith, brother Theodore Brown, Jr., biological father Theodore Brown, Sr., and close friend Barbara Smoot. Barbara is survived by her five children, Hershel Thompson, Jr., Elaine Robinson, Anthony (Raynetta) Thompson, Ernestine (Terry) Johnson, and Gregory Thompson; sisters, Dianne (James) Sicery of California, and Shirley Munnerlyn of Ohio; grandchildren, Sharon (Curtis) Ward, Chris Thompson, Eric Thompson, Donny (Misty) Thompson and Terri Ann (Charles) Stanford; a host of great grandchildren, including Chaniqua Berry, Jayquan Thompson, Jaymon Cornett, Anthony and Trayveon (Terri Ann), to name a few; and great-great grandchildren including Jenya, Makenzie, and Rose'Anna (Chaniqua); sister-in-law Teresa Brown of California; other relatives and dear friends, including Fern Moore and JoAnne Roy.
